The African Union (AU) is Africa's most representative and internationally influential body. It was the first regional international organization to sign a Belt and Road cooperation plan with China, and the AU Commission is a member of the Forum on China-Africa Cooperation (FOCAC). CGTN's Wang Mangmang spoke to the AU's permanent representative to China, Rahmat Allah Mohamed Osman, to find out how China-Africa relations have developed.
